  1. A fine, wispy strand of hair at the edge of a person's (usually a woman's) hairline. countable,dialectal,usually
    — Medium size cornrows going back with a curl at the end of each braid. A silky, smooth, hairline, highlighted with soft black baby hairs.
  2. The hair of a baby. uncountable
  3. Any immature or fine strand of hair, or (uncountably) a collection of such hairs. (Compare baby tooth, baby fat.) countable,uncountable
    — You shed your hair, too. Old hairs fall out nearly every day, and new baby hairs grow in their places .
